Summary

Palliative care is a special type of medical care that focuses on providing support and improving the quality of life for individuals facing life-threatening illnesses. Nursing care for patients receiving enteral nutrition includes interventions that facilitate nutrition, increase patient comfort, and reduce complications. This study will be conducted as a randomized controlled experimental study to evaluate the effects of abdominal massage and in-bed exercise on gastrointestinal complications and patient comfort in palliative care patients.

Detailed description

Abdominal Massage Group Application Steps * In this group, patients will receive abdominal massage by the researcher in addition to routine care, with privacy provided. * Abdominal massage will be applied to the patient by the researcher every morning between 07-08 and 19-20 for 3 days before enteral feeding, and measurements will be recorded 24 hours after the application at 07-08 in the morning. The timing and frequency of massage application were decided according to studies in the literature and expert opinions. * Before abdominal massage, the patient will be placed in a supine position and will remain in the same position throughout the procedure. * For abdominal massage, superficial effleurage, deep effleurage, petrissage, vibration, and superficial effleurage maneuvers will be applied to the patient for approximately 15 minutes, respectively. * After the application, the patient will be placed in a semi-fawler position. In-bed Exercise Group Application Steps In-bed exercise application will be applied to the patient by the researcher every morning between 07-08 for 3 days before enteral feeding and measurements will be recorded 24 hours after the application. Before the in-bed exercise application, the patient will be placed in a supine position and will be kept in the same position throughout the procedure. For the in-bed exercise application to the patient; opening and closing the wrist and fingers inwards and outwards, opening and closing the elbow and arm, turning the arm right and left at the level of the head, ankle up and down and right and left, bending and releasing the hip and knee, opening and closing the leg sideways, pushing and pulling the hip and knee 90 ͦ, and leg movements in the up and down direction will be applied for approximately 15 minutes. After the application, the patient will be placed in the semi-fawler position. Control Group Application Steps * Standard nursing care will be applied to the patient.
